WF06 TUW is a 2006 Mercedes-benz Cls in Black with a 2,987c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 88.9%.
Across all 2006 Mercedes-benz Cls models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.5% with a typical mileage of 81,294 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Mercedes-benz Cls f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 8,450 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WF06 TUW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mercedes-benz Cls typ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 20 years old, this Mercedes-benz Cls is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
